Luxor Cafe: Japan’s Rising Hope for Kentucky Derby Glory

Bred for Distance, Built for Speed

 

Out of the turf-winning mare Mary’s Follies and by 2015 Triple Crown champion American Pharoah, Luxor Cafe carries a blend of class and versatility in his pedigree. While American Pharoah’s progeny have thrived mainly on grass, Luxor Cafe has shown he can transfer that class to dirt with four wins from six starts on Japanese soil. 

His dam, Mary’s Follies, won the Boiling Springs and Mrs. Revere Stakes in 2009, both on turf, suggesting versatility and strong finishing power.

Trained by Noriyuki Hori and ridden by João Moreira, both newcomers to the Kentucky Derby scene, Luxor Cafe adds an international dynamic to this year’s field. Moreira, one of the most accomplished jockeys in Asia, brings global experience to a horse who has yet to race outside Japan.

 

Streaking into Derby Form

 

Luxor Cafe began its career with two losses but quickly turned things around. Since breaking his maiden last November, the gray colt has gone unbeaten in four straight races. Among those victories, the Hyacinth Stakes stands out. There, he defeated fellow Kentucky Derby hopefuls Promised Gene and Admire Daytona in a tightly contested finish.

The objective statement came in the Fukuryu Stakes, where Luxor Cafe crushed the field by five lengths. His final three-eighths clocked in at a blistering 36.51 seconds, showcasing elite acceleration and stamina that could translate well at the 1 ¼-mile distance of the Kentucky Derby.

Japan has yet to produce a Kentucky Derby winner in eight tries, but the gap appears to be closing. Last year, Forever Young finished third, signaling growing international competitiveness.

Luxor Cafe enters the Derby with a stalker’s running style, a versatile gear that could be effective in a crowded 20-horse field. His ability to sit just off the pace and then unleash a powerful stretch run makes him a legitimate contender, especially if the early fractions are quick.
